A user guide designed to help administrative staff and faculty provide registration approval to individual students using the Banner form SFASRPO.
SFASRPO用户指南Students can enroll via their 学生中心 through the self-add deadline, which is calculated as 6% of the course duration (excluding Final Exam Week) for full-term courses, as long as they meet the prerequisites and other registration requirements. 请参考 Part-of-Term图表 in the 类调度 Forms dropdown for dates for all parts of term. Please note that some departments may not allow registration within the first week of the semester.
If students are given permission to enroll beyond the self-add deadline prior to census (50% drop refund deadline) individuals designated in each department will update SFASRPO in Banner to allow the student to self-enroll. The 司法常务官办公室 will mass apply “DP” (Department Approval) requirements on all courses after the self-enroll deadline has passed.

From the time self-add closes until census day (50% drop refund deadline), students will have to obtain department permission to enroll. 如果得到批准, the department will utilize the current process for department approval to provide permission in Banner in SFASRPO so that the student can enroll themselves via the hub.
Students will only be able to add themselves until the self add-deadline. For specific deadlines, please refer to the 校历.
11点59分.m. 在自添加截止日期, the remaining students on the waitlist will be purged (meaning they will no longer appear on the waitlist on the student and faculty view).
The waitlist must be purged on this date in order to be able to allow students to waitlist for later parts of term. We want to be consistent and have the ability to offer the waitlist option to all parts of term.
